Action Against Hunger’s External Relations Department seeks a resourceful and creative Content Lead, who believes in the power of storytelling to mobilize public support to end hunger and respond to humanitarian emergencies. This individual is an expert in content strategy and execution, is deeply knowledgeable in international development and humanitarian issues, and excels in writing, editing, and managing complex priorities under tight deadlines.
Reporting to the Associate Director of Communications, the Content Lead is responsible for overseeing all website content and a broad range of communications assets, to achieve fundraising, advocacy, and brand visibility goals. They manage content creation from concept through publication, oversee content collection efforts in country offices, and manage an extensive asset library on behalf of the US office. They will be responsible for managing two staff members on the Communications team.
The ideal candidate works respectfully and diplomatically with diverse teams, is high performing, feels a sense of urgency to respond to humanitarian aid crises, brings creativity, organization, and a sense of humor to work every day, and believes strongly in our mission.
Purpose: Lead on website content strategy, strategy execution, production, and asset management
Engagement: Collaborate with Communications, Direct Marketing, and country office teams, and external consultants
Delivery: Develop strategy and implementation plans for web content, project manage and execute on editorial calendar, write and edit for communication strategy outcomes, and tell the story of ACF to multiple audiences
